Early Life and Beginnings
Bob Verne, born on July 14, 1944, in the vibrant city of Miami Beach, Florida, was destined for greatness from a young age. Growing up, he was drawn to the world of entertainment and dreamed of making a mark in the film industry. His passion for acting was ignited early on, and he pursued his dreams with unwavering determination.
Rise to Stardom
Bob Verne's breakthrough came with his role in the 1985 film "Cavegirl," where he captivated audiences with his charisma and talent. This was followed by a memorable performance in the 1988 film "The Immortalizer," which solidified his reputation as a versatile actor with immense potential. His portrayal of Lyle in "The Immortalizer" earned him critical acclaim and opened doors to new opportunities in the industry.
Family and Legacy
Behind the scenes, Bob Verne was a devoted family man, with his daughter Krista Vernoff, who would go on to become the executive producer and showrunner of the hit series "Grey's Anatomy." His granddaughter, Cosette, is a testament to his enduring legacy and the impact he has had on future generations of talented individuals.
